Maximilien Luce's "Les scieurs, paysage de La Cure" depicts a serene rural landscape, showcasing his characteristic use of color and light. The painting features a river flowing through a verdant valley, bordered by trees in various shades of green and gold. In the foreground, two figures are depicted sawing a log, capturing a moment of daily life in the countryside. The composition emphasizes the tranquility of the scene, with the peaceful river and soft, cloud-filled sky evoking a sense of serenity. The painting is representative of Luce's transition from Impressionism to a more personal style, highlighting the beauty of nature in a distinctive and evocative manner.
